Conceptual positions of category of safety in legal science
Abstract
The concept of security is considered in this article. In legal science, security is understood as a condition of protection of interests of the individual, society and the state from threats. Conclusion that the safety and stability are interconnected to each other and determine each other was drawn.
The components of safety – rights and individual freedoms, interests of society, interests of the state are defined. The comparative analysis of legal practice of Russian Federation and Republic of Kazakhstan is carried out in area of providing of national safety. Conclusion about the necessity of further perfection of legislative base of Republic of Kazakhstan in the area of providing of national safety was made.
